Preguntas frecuentes acerca de apartamentos baratos en el código postal 32714

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ento barato de un dormitorio en 32714?

El precio más bajo de un apartamento barato de un dormitorio en 32714 es $692 en Shadowood Park.

¿Cuál es el precio más bajo para un apartamento de alquiler barato de dos dormitorios en 32714?

La mejor oferta de hoy para un apartamento barato de dos dormitorios en 32714 comienza a partir de $780 en Normandy Manor Apartments.

¿Cuál el apartamento de tres dormitorios más asequible en 32714?

La mejor oferta de un apartamento de alquiler de tres dormitorios barato en 32714 está en Shadowood Park empezando en $959.
